Sans Normal Emfe 14 is a very light, normal width, low contrast, italic, normal x-height font.

A very light, monoline italic with rounded construction and smooth, continuous curves. Strokes maintain a consistent thinness with softly tapered terminals, and joins stay clean without sharp breaks. Proportions are slightly condensed in places with lively, variable character widths, giving the line a gentle, flowing rhythm. Counters are open and circular, and the overall texture remains bright and uncluttered, especially at larger sizes.
Best suited to branding, packaging, and editorial headlines where a light, graceful italic can provide a refined tone. It also works well for short passages, pull quotes, and display typography where its open forms and delicate strokes can breathe on the page.
The font conveys a quiet, contemporary elegance—light on its feet and approachable rather than formal. Its italic slant and rounded forms add a subtle handwritten warmth while staying clearly typographic and controlled.
The design appears intended to deliver a modern, minimal italic with a friendly, rounded voice—prioritizing smooth geometry and an airy texture for contemporary display and brand applications.
Uppercase forms lean toward simple geometric silhouettes (notably round C/O/Q) paired with a few sharper diagonals in A/V/W/X that add sparkle without disrupting the softness. The lowercase shows single-storey shapes (e.g., a) and smooth, looped constructions that emphasize continuity; numerals follow the same airy, rounded logic for a cohesive page color.
